Output ec1b92fed13df8cfc6fa6a2d274f39705022f5cc547df825f672dfbd15c04125:1

value
759485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e673da442b1ec7eedc58e783570868aa345775f8 OP_EQUAL
address
3NhY8F9S1iSVRnfKe5p2iRZpGmWzSXVp3K
transaction
ec1b92fed13df8cfc6fa6a2d274f39705022f5cc547df825f672dfbd15c04125
confirmations
92422
spent
true